29th October 1996-New Division Two, Watford 1 Luton Town 1

BSAD imageBSAD report:It makes a change for us to play Luton when they’re on a roll – it’s usually us enjoying a good run which, inevitably, comes to a sticky end against our local rivals. But nothing much changes – April 1987 was the last time we beat them in a proper match (the Anglo-Italian cup, in which you were allowed to name everyone in the ground as a substitute and play rush goalie, doesn’t count and we know it).

20th April 1996- New Division One, Luton Town 0 Watford 0

The most important local derby for years and, perhaps inevitably, it ends in massive anticlimax. We may be able to take some consolation from the fact that Luton’s season has been as bad as ours but the knowledge that we’ll have to visit this hellhole of an away end (where there’s so little legroom you can’t even sit in the seat you’ve paid stlg 12.50 for) next season doesn’t exactly fill my heart with joy.

21st November 1995- New Division One, Watford 1 Luton Town 1

Eight and a half bloody years! If you don’t count the Anglo-Italian (and, let’s face it, nobody does), that’s how long it is since we beat Luton. To Watford fans, that really hurts. On the evidence of this awful performance, we’ll be waiting for a hell of a long time.
